End of Season Party - Tamworth
The riders' end of season party - Tamworth
Another fine turn out from the UK Snowboard Forum and the Milton Keynes locals showing nuff respect saw a great turn out for the End of Season Party at the Tamworth Snowdome. Russ Shea from Document was also along for some shots for next year's brochures with Hamish Duncan and Rob Yeomans in tow. Thus, with MK yoof in the form of James Carr, Laura Berry and Steve Revill we had some great riding guaranteed along side those who came for some laughs. The guys from NewSchoolProductions were also there and we hear they're putting together a new Tamworth based film. DJ Shiny was in his usual happy little world on the decks and span tunes for much of the night. Crazy Ninja put on entries to the amateur video competition and we'll have details of how to vote soon. On the slope, Tamworth had pulled out the stops. The Jackson box at the top, followed by three kickers on the way down the slope, the gas pipe, new double-stepped picnic benches, a new straight rail, a gapped kinked rail all rounded off nicely with the quarter pipe still topped with the hellish tombstone from the Quarter Slaughter. Russ also caught Laura Berry jumping the picnics tables whilst a group of us sat around pretending to be without a care in the world. Hopefully Russ won't trash his microdrive before getting these to print this time. Thanks to Laura for leaving me in one piece, being last to the table I was nearest the jump. Go figure. So, a big thanks to Gary at the SnowDome and for all those who came, fell, drank and generally had a great time. Roll on the Forum Summer Bash.
